At MAHLE, as a leading international development partner and systems supplier to the automotive industry, we pursue the objective of making mobility more efficient, more environmentally friendly, more convenient, and more economical. As part of our dual strategy, we are working both on the intelligent combustion engine for the use of hydrogen and other nonfossil fuels and on technologies for fuel cells and e-mobility.

MAHLE generated sales of €11.3 billion in 2025. Employing just under 65,000 people at 127 production locations and 11 technology centers, the company is represented in 28 countries. (as at: 12/31/2025). Join our MAHLE team! #weshapefuturemobility
